Understanding Caliber Basics



The understanding of caliber basics is basic for people taking part in shooting activities, as it forms the basis for selecting proper ammo for different firearms. Caliber describes the size of the projectile or the birthed of the gun, and it plays a critical role in figuring out the sort of ammunition that can be securely and successfully utilized in a certain gun. Caliber dimensions are normally revealed in millimeters or inches, with usual examples consisting of.22, 9mm,.45, and.50 caliber.


It is vital to match the caliber of the ammo to the details firearm being used to ensure proper working and accuracy. Using the wrong quality ammunition can not just cause unsafe breakdowns but likewise position significant security dangers to the shooter and those in the bordering area. Before packing or acquiring ammo, shooters must carefully check the weapon's specifications to identify the right caliber for optimal efficiency.


Discovering Bullet Kinds and Styles

Checking out the varied series of bullet kinds and styles readily available is vital for shooters seeking to enhance their understanding of ammo option and efficiency. Bullets come in different shapes and compositions, each offering different purposes and supplying unique features that can influence precision, penetration, and terminal ballistics.


One usual difference among bullets is between complete steel coat (FMJ) and hollow point (HP) layouts. FMJ bullets feature a soft core encased in a more challenging metal shell, offering trustworthy penetration and minimal development upon impact. On the other hand, HP bullets are created to increase upon striking a target, moving more power and developing a bigger wound tooth cavity.




Additionally, shooters may run into boat-tail bullets, which have a conical base that minimizes drag for enhanced long-range accuracy, and frangible bullets, which disintegrate upon effect, making them ideal for training or close-quarters situations. By understanding the attributes and objectives of various bullet types, shooters can make informed decisions when selecting ammunition for their specific capturing needs.

Considering Meant Usage and Capturing Objectives



To optimize shooting performance and achieve wanted outcomes, it is critical to line up ammo options with the specific intended use and shooting objectives of the gun. Whether the objective is affordable capturing, hunting, protection, or recreational target practice, choosing the best ammo can dramatically influence the outcomes.


For competitive shooters, uniformity and accuracy are paramount - XTP. They frequently select high-quality match-grade ammunition customized to their details firearm to boost precision and integrity. Seekers, on the various other hand, may focus on elements like bullet weight, caliber, and incurable ballistics to make certain efficient and moral video game takedowns


Individuals concentrated on protection might prioritize expansion and penetration abilities in their ammunition option to take full advantage of quiting power and reduce over-penetration threats. For those engaging in recreational shooting, factors like recoil, accessibility, and expense might play an extra significant function in their ammo options.
